600History and Growth:
Internet poker surfaced inside belated 1990s because of developments in technology while the internet. 1st on-line poker space, globe Poker, premiered in 1998, attracting a small but enthusiastic neighborhood. But was at the early 2000s that online poker experienced exponential growth, mostly as a result of the introduction of real-money games and televised poker tournaments.

Recognition and Accessibility:
One of the most significant known reasons for the immense popularity of on-line poker is its ease of access. People can get on a common on-line poker systems at any time, from everywhere, employing their computers or mobile devices. This convenience has attracted a diverse player base, which range from recreational players to professionals, contributing to the quick development of online poker.

Benefits of Online Poker:
Online poker provides a number of benefits over traditional brick-and-mortar gambling enterprises. Firstly, it gives a larger array of online game choices, including various poker alternatives and stakes, catering into the preferences and spending plans of forms of people. Furthermore, on-line poker areas are available 24/7, eliminating the constraints of physical casino running hours. Moreover, online platforms often offer attractive bonuses, respect programs, and the capacity to play multiple tables at the same time, boosting the general video gaming experience.
